Shillong, the capital of Meghalaya, is a hidden treasure in the northeastern part of India. It is a popular hill station and tourist destination in India, and is known as the “Scotland of the East” due to its striking resemblance to the Scottish Highlands.

An History that binds Shillong’s beauty

Shillong is surrounded by breathtaking waterfalls, crystal clear lakes, and towering mountains. It is Meghalaya’s capital and an ideal place to unwind in the midst of natural beauty and serenity. The city takes its name from the deity Shyllong, also known as Lei Shyllong.

Shillong was nearly destroyed by a powerful earthquake in 1897. With sheer determination and hard work, the people of Meghalaya rebuilt the city from the ground up. If you are looking for a mental detox away from the monotony of city life, this heavenly vacation spot is ideal.

Shillong’s magnificent mountain peaks provide a breathtaking view of the city. Its crystal clear lakes and waterfalls exemplify magnificence, and its sheer serenity will truly soothe your soul. Furthermore, as the home of the Khasi, Jaintia, and Garo hill tribes, you will be able to observe the city’s vibrant lifestyle and cultural traditions.

Shillong was the capital of Assam during the British regime until the formation of the separate state of Meghalaya in 1972, and it served as the Summer capital of Eastern Bengal and Assam for several years. Best time to visit Shillong:

When is the best time to visit Shillong? Shillong has pleasant weather all year and can be visited at any time. Let’s take a look at the different seasons throughout the year to help you plan your trip better.

  1. Summer (March to June): Temperatures in the summer range between 15°C and 24°C. This is an excellent time to go sightseeing and plan adventure activities for your upcoming summer vacation.
  • Monsoon (June to September): During these months, Shillong experiences average to heavy rainfall, with July being the wettest month. This is an excellent time to visit the waterfalls and take in the beautiful rain-washed scenery.
  • Winter season (October to February): In Shillong, rainfall begins to decline in October, and winter arrives in early November, with temperatures as low as 2°C. The hill town looks heavenly during the winter months, making it an excellent choice for your winter vacation.

Shillong’s most widely spoken languages are:

  • Khasi
  • Pnar
  • Garo
  • English

How to Get to Shillong: Shillong Flights?

Shillong Flights: Shillong Airport, also known as Umroi Airport, is located 30 kilometres from the city centre. On the Regional Connectivity Scheme (RCS) route,

Goibibonow operates a daily nonstop flight from Shillong to Kolkata. Shillong is also close to the airport of Guwahati, the state capital of Assam. A four-hour drive on NH 40 from Guwahati to Shillong will get you there.

By train: The nearest railway station to Shillong Airport is Guwahati Railway Station in Paltan Bazaar, which is 90 kilometres away.

By bus: Buses run almost every half hour between Shillong and Guwahati. Another viable option is to hire a taxi.

Shillong’s rich cultural heritage, pleasant weather, and enthralling landscape make it an ideal vacation destination for people of all ages. It is India’s only hill station that is accessible from all sides, making it convenient to visit.

The Khasi community is a matrilineal society, which is an interesting fact about them. As a result, the children inherit the mother’s surname, and the youngest daughter inherits the ancestral property. Make Shillong a stop on your bucket list for a relaxing experience!

Shillong’s local festivals, like the sprawling green hills that surround the city, will captivate you! The Khasi community considers several dance festivals, such as Ka Shad Suk Mynsiem, Ka Pom-Blang Nongkrem, and Ka-Shad Shyngwiang-Thangiap. The Garos tribe celebrates jhum cultivation and nature, with three major festivals: Den Bilsia, Wangala, and Rongchu Gala. Behdienkhlam, which includes the Laho Dance form, is an important festival for the Jaintias tribe, which prioritises cultural heritage preservation and people-to-people solidarity.
